Counter Terrorism Awareness Week

25th November 2014

Following yesterday’s launch of counter-terrorism awareness week, Northumbria’s Police & Crime Commissioner, Vera Baird is working in partnership with our communities to ensure we keep Tyne & Wear and Northumberland safe.

The awareness message from this week’s national campaign is

Be alert!

Vera Baird QC said “Thousands of people make daily trips around our region and Northumbria Police work hard to keep our communities safe.  The Police receive lots of information from the community on a range of topics, and all we are asking is that people continue to remain vigilant and report anything suspicious to the police.  By working together we will keep our towns and cities safe”.

Mrs Baird added “local people’s eyes and ears are a great surveillance tool, if local people tell the police, or bus drivers, train drivers about anything they see suspicious, the police stand every chance of detecting and stopping any incidences that could occur. Protecting our region remains a top priority for myself and Northumbria Police, we will continue to work with all agencies”
